In today's rapidly evolving digital landscape, Australian businesses face increasing pressure to adopt sophisticated software solutions. But beyond the lines of code lies a deeper layer that significantly impacts the success and longevity of your technology investments: the underlying philosophy of the frameworks upon which these solutions are built.
This isn't about semicolons and curly braces. We're diving into the core philosophies that shape how software is architected, how it scales, and how adaptable it is to your unique business needs. For Australian business owners and executives, understanding these foundational concepts can be the key to choosing the right technology partners and ensuring your software investments deliver long-term value and a competitive edge. Let's explore some of the key philosophical underpinnings that drive modern framework design and why they matter to your business.
One of the central tenets of modern frameworks is modularity. Think of it like building with LEGO bricks – individual components that can be assembled, disassembled, and rearranged with relative ease. For your business, this translates to greater agility. Need to add a new feature? Modular frameworks allow developers to integrate it without overhauling the entire system. This means faster time-to-market and reduced costs for future enhancements. Architectures like microservices and component-based designs exemplify this philosophy, allowing for independent development and deployment of specific functionalities.
Another guiding philosophy is convention over configuration. Modern frameworks aim to reduce the burden of endless setup by establishing sensible defaults for common tasks. This efficiency directly impacts your bottom line. Less time spent on configuration means faster development, fewer potential points of error, and ultimately, a more robust and reliable software solution for your Australian enterprise. Frameworks like Ruby on Rails are well-known for their adherence to this principle, streamlining development workflows.

Scalability and performance are not afterthoughts in modern framework design; they are deeply ingrained principles. These frameworks are built to handle increasing demands without compromising speed or reliability. As your Australian business expands, your software needs to keep pace. Frameworks built with scalability in mind ensure your systems can handle increased user traffic and data volumes, providing a seamless experience for your customers and efficient operations for your team. Cloud-native architectures and the use of asynchronous processing are common strategies employed to achieve this.
Beyond the initial build, the long-term health of your software is paramount. Modern frameworks prioritise maintainability, making it easier for developers to understand, update, and extend the codebase over time. Investing in software built on well-maintained frameworks reduces the risk of technical debt and costly overhauls down the line. This ensures your technology remains a valuable asset for your Australian business for years to come. Clear architectural patterns and well-documented code, often enforced by the framework, contribute significantly to maintainability.
Understanding the underlying philosophies of modularity, efficiency through convention, robust scalability, optimal performance, and inherent maintainability is crucial when evaluating software solutions for your Australian business. At C9, we don't just build software; we architect solutions based on these very principles. Our approach to custom software, app development, integration, and database solutions is rooted in creating robust, scalable, and maintainable systems that drive tangible results for Australian businesses. Whether you need a bespoke application to streamline operations, seamless integration between disparate systems, or a robust database solution to power your growth, C9's expertise ensures your technology investments are built on a solid philosophical foundation.
Ready to leverage the power of thoughtfully designed software frameworks for your Australian business? Contact C9 today for a consultation to discuss your unique software needs and discover how our philosophy-driven approach can deliver a competitive advantage. Visit our website to explore our portfolio of custom software, app development, integration, and database solutions for Australian businesses. As Australia's leading custom software, apps, integration & database developer, C9 is committed to delivering innovative and reliable technology solutions tailored to the Australian market.
Programming Languages & Frameworks: Architecting Bespoke Technical Solutions that Transcend Conventional Development
In today's competitive landscape, pre-packaged development approaches severely limit your organisation's ability to differentiate and scale. Our Programming Languages & Frameworks services elevate beyond standard implementation—creating precision-engineered technical ecosystems that align perfectly with your unique operational requirements and strategic vision.
We transform generic coding approaches into strategic competitive advantages through expert evaluation, implementation and optimisation. This isn't simply about writing code—it's about engineering technological foundations that empower your organisation to respond with unprecedented agility to market opportunities while maintaining robust scalability.
Programming Languages & Frameworks Development in Brisbane
Programming Languages & Frameworks Developers Services in Melbourne
Expert Programming Languages & Frameworks Development in Sydney
Transform Your Business with Precision .NET Development
Brisbane's Premier ASP.NET Boilerplate & Zero Development Experts
Sydney's Strategic .NET Development Ecosystem
Melbourne's Strategic .NET Development Ecosystem
Master Programming Languages & Frameworks with Brisbane’s Leading Developers
Sydney's Premier ASP.NET Boilerplate & Zero Development
Melbourne's Premier AspNetBoilerplate & AspNetZero Development Solutions
Programming Languages & Frameworks - Developers | C9
ASP.NET Boilerplate Developers | Custom Tech | C9
Brisbane .NET Developers | Custom Software Solutions | C9
Expert AspNetBoilerplate & AspNetZero Developers | C9
.NET Developers | Custom http://ASP.NET Solutions | C9
ASP.NET Boilerplate & Zero Developers | Expert Services | C9
.NET Developers | Custom C# & http://ASP.NET Services | C9